In the 42nd minute, the frustration started to boil over for Colorado.
After a bad giveaway, Talley hustled back to win the ball but ended committing a hard foul on the Rapids' Niko Hernandez instead. Even though the ref didn't issue a yellow card, Colorado midfielder Kyle Beckerman was infuriated by the foul and came racing in from 20 yards away to shove Talley.
Even as the halftime whistle blew, Talley and Beckerman continued jawing at each other all the way into the Invesco Field tunnel.
"They talk a lot tougher than they really are," joked Talley after the game.
Just six minutes into the second half, the Rapids should've realistically tied it up. After replacing Clint Mathis at the half, Fabrice Noel wasted a fantastic scoring opportunity when he knocked a Terry Cooke cross over the crossbar from five yards out.
That opened the door for Salt Lake to run away with it.
Colorado's Thiago Martins and RSL's Chris Brown each scored goals in the final 10 minutes as Real scored four goals for the first time in franchise history.
